Theatre of Bacchus, Athens, with James 'Athenian' Stuart shown sketching in the foreground

RIBA3757
NOTES: It is likely this drawing dates from between 1751 and 1754, during Stuart's extensive travels in Greece.This image also appeared as an engraving in Stuart & Revett's 'The Antiquities of Athens' (London, 1787), vol. II, ch. iii, pl. I.

Amphitheatre at Pola (Pula): view from the west

RIBA3978
NOTES: It is likely this drawing dates from between 1751 and 1754, during Stuart's extensive travels in Greece.This image also later appeared as an engraving in Stuart & Revett's 'The Antiquities of Athens' (London, 1816), vol. IV, ch. i, pl. I.
